I am having problems trying to send a word document (with a web site
hyperlink) and the same link in the message body of an email. The word file
is my CV and the link relates to my web site where examples of my work can be
found (i.e nothing dodgy, im just looking for a new job). The word document
has also been converted as pdf with the web site link. Both document links
work fine outside of outlook express.

The message will send (can see the progress bar), but it is not recieved and
does not show up on the virgin server? I have sent this to my self to proove
this. If i re-send the message without the word document, with the hyperlink
removed from the message body and only the pdf attached, it works fine?

I have enabled pop3 on the virgin server, used the recent virgin message fix
tool and un-checked "do not allow attachements" within oultook and still it
wont send the discussed message?

Please can you help me to fix this as i really need to send out my CV with
the web site link, thank you.

I am using:

@virgin.net (email account)
Outlook express 6
XP home service pack 2
Word 2002
adobe reader 9
avg free 8.5
windows firewall

AVG never gets its e-mail scanning hooks off your messages. Remove AVG and
then do a custom installation opting out of all e-mail scanning when it is
offered.

Uninstall AVG & reboot, then do a fresh install of AVG Free 9.0. [1] This
time select the CUSTOM install option and do NOT install (i.e., uncheck)
Linkscanner, Search-Shield, Active Surf-Shield, Security toolbar, or any of
the email scanning components.

• Why you don't need your anti-virus to scan your email
http://thundercloud.net/infoave/tuto...ning/index.htm

================
[1] Or consider replacing AVG with Microsoft Security Essentials
(http://www.microsoft.com/security_es...s/default.aspx) or Avira AntiVir
(http://www.free-av.com/en/trialpay_d...antivirus.htm),
both free and much more reliable than AVG IMHO.
